LESSON OBJECTIVES Upon completion of this program, the home health aide will be able to: Explain the differences between influenza and the common cold Describe how influenza is spread, and List three ways to protect patients from the flu virus OVERVIEW The influenza virus, also known as the flu, killed 36,000 Americans in 2003. Of the 36,000, more than 32,000 were 65 or older, despite 2003 having the highest immunization rate of any year on record. Over 83 million were immunized in 2003, and yet only 60 percent of those were senior citizens. The flu and pneumonia (the most common flu complication) combined are the fifth leading cause of death among Americans age 65 and older. The best and most effective way to protect elderly patients from the flu begins with health care workers. Aides and other health care workers must be vaccinated against the flu to help ensure they do not get the virus and transmit it to their patients and co-workers. This in-service provides an in-depth look at the flu and how to protect patients during flu season. Knowing all there is to know about the flu helps aides provide the best care for their patients.

LESSON OBJECTIVES After completion of this program, the home health aide will be able to: * Describe two reasons why homecare surveys are performed * List three primary methods for surveying home health aide services * Explain the responsibilities of the home health aide during home visits LESSON OVERVIEW The survey of homecare agencies is an anxious time for all concerned. It is particularly troublesome for home health aides since they often do not understand how the survey is conducted and what role they are expected to play. Failure to meet the standard for home health aide services can result in a Condition-level deficiency for the agency. During a survey, home visits will be made to observe home health aide care delivery. Aide documentation and employee files will be reviewed. The topic of the survey is an important one for home health aides since they will always be directly and indirectly involved in the process. The information presented in this program will help to explain the process, as well as outline the responsibilities of the home health aide during a survey.

LESSON OVERVIEW There is a general perception that seizures occur more often in infants and children, and are rare in older adults and the elderly. The truth is that seizure disorders increase in both incidence and prevalence after age 60. While seizure disorder is not a common primary diagnosis for homecare patients, it is not at all uncommon for homecare patients to have seizure disorders as additional diagnoses. Many homecare patients are diabetic and any of them could be subject to seizures with severe hypoglycemia. For those reasons it is very important for home health aides to have a basic understanding of seizures, why they occur and what should be done when a patient has a seizure. The purpose of this in-service program is to provide information home health aides need in order to care for patients with seizure disorders, and to provide basic first aid information to clarify some confusing information they may have thought to be true.
